MOLTT Montessori Spindle Box: A Concrete Pathway to Understanding Quantity & the Concept of Zero
Product Overview
The MOLTT Spindle Box is a foundational Montessori mathematics material designed to provide children with a clear, tangible experience of the relationship between numerical symbols and their corresponding quantities. Through hands-on manipulation, it introduces the abstract notion of numbers 0 through 9 and the pivotal concept of "zero" in an intuitive, self-correcting manner.
Material Composition & Design
This complete set is meticulously crafted for both durability and educational clarity:
Two Wooden Boxes: Each box features five compartments arranged in a single row.
Clear Numerical Labels: The compartments in the first box are clearly marked with the numerals 0, 1, 2, 3, and 4. The second box is labeled 5, 6, 7, 8, and 9.
45 Wooden Spindles: The set includes exactly 45 smooth, uniform wooden rods or "spindles" designed for easy handling by small hands. This precise quantity is intentional and serves a critical self-correcting function.
Primary Educational Purpose
The core objectives of this material are to:
Solidify Symbol-Quantity Association: Move the child from an abstract numeral to the concrete reality of "how many" it represents.
Introduce the Concept of Zero: Provide a powerful, visible demonstration that "0" means "nothing" or an empty set through the empty compartment.
Reinforce Cardinality: Ensure the child understands that the last number counted represents the total quantity of the set.
The Learning Process & Key Features
Hands-On Counting & Fine Motor Development: The child takes the loose pile of 45 spindles and, for each compartment, counts out the exact quantity indicated by the numeral, placing the spindles inside. This action refines fine motor skills, hand-eye coordination, and careful, accurate counting.
The Self-Correcting Mechanism (Control of Error): The genius of the material lies in its built-in feedback. Since the total number of spindles is exactly the sum of 0 through 9 (45 spindles), any error in counting will result in leftover spindles or a shortage at the end. This allows the child to independently recognize and correct their mistake, fostering autonomy, problem-solving, and a precise mathematical mind.
Tangible Introduction to Zero: The compartment marked "0" remains conspicuously empty. The child physically experiences that zero means receiving no spindles, creating a lasting, concrete impression of this fundamental mathematical idea.
